LAWRENCE — Kansas basketball’s regular season continues with Tuesday’s non-conference matchup at home against Texas A&M-Corpus Christi.
The No. 24 Jayhawks (1-1) are looking to bounce back after a loss on the road against now-No. 20 North Carolina. The Islanders (1-2) have lost back-to-back games on the road coming into this game. KU won its only other game to date inside Allen Fieldhouse this season against Green Bay.
Ahead of tip-off, scheduled for 7 p.m. (CT) in Lawrence, here are five things to think about:
